Design, kinematics, and prototyping of a gripping mechanism to adapt large space

Junjie Ji,
Song-Tao Wei,
Jing-Shan Zhao

Abstract: This manuscript introduces a symmetrical gripping mechanism, a significant piece of robotic equipment, adept at adjusting to the variable dimensions of disparate objects within an extensive range. The innovative mechanism presented in this treatise has dual degrees of freedom (DOF), and its parameters can be customized to satisfy diverse requirements.
